CTAE Student Organizations

Career Technology Student Organizations are integral parts of career and technology education courses towards preparing students to become college and career ready. CTSO enhance student learning through leadership and personal development, applied learning and real world application. Here at DHSTN students participates in activities and competitive events at the local, regional, state and national levels of the various CTSOs.

Future Business Leaders of America-Phi Beta Lambda is a nonprofit education association of students preparing for careers in business and business-related fields. The FBLA Mission is to bring business and education together in a positive working relationship through innovative leadership and career development programs. Associated Programs: Business Pathway
 
 TSA
 
Technology Student Association (TSA) is a national, non-profit organization for students with an interest in technology. TSA members learn problem-solving, decision-making, critical thinking and leadership skills as they relate to design, communications, power, energy, transportation, engineering, manufacturing, construction and biotechnology. TSA strives to meet the educational needs and challenges of all students in an increasingly and ever-changing technological world. Associated Programs: Manufacturing and Engineering Pathway
 
 
 
HOSA is a national student organization endorsed by the U.S. Department of Education and the Health Science Technology Education Division of ACTE. HOSA's two-fold mission is to promote career opportunities in the health care industry and to enhance the delivery of quality health care to all people. HOSA's goal is to encourage all health occupations instructors and students to join and be actively involved in the HSTE-HOSA Partnership. Associated Programs: Dental Science, Patient Care/Nursing Pathway
 
 
 
SkillsUSA is national organization that provides quality education experiences for students in leadership, teamwork, citizenship and character development. It builds and reinforces self-confidence, work attitudes and communications skills. It emphasizes total quality at work, high ethical standards, superior work skills, life-long education and pride in the dignity of work. SkillsUSA also promotes understanding of the free enterprise system and involvement in community service activities. Associated Programs: Automotive, Construction, Cosmetology and Information Technology Pathway
